我正在开发我的第一个谷歌应用程序脚本(GAS)附加。具体来说,我正在尝试重新部署我编写的现有脚本(特别是带工作表的脚本),并使用一个Web作为附加程序。
Web应用程序的目的是在启用此附加组件时公开给定工作表的UX。如果可能,如何以编程方式获得工作表的Web端点?这是以下对话框中的Current web app URL:目标是只对给定的域私自发布附加组件。我的备用方案是手动安装(例如复制和粘贴)我需要它的每个工作表中的现有脚本。
在前面的代码中,我直接使用doGet()调用ScriptApp.getService().getUrl()方法,因此其他按钮在加载新的ScriptApp.getService().getUrl()页面时没有任何问题第一次我试过:
var html = ScriptApp.getService().getUrl()+"?center;font-style: italic;font-size: 12px;">This Document ID do not exist